Searching for the Best Locations of Service Facilities Along the Freeway
Two models were used to find the optimal locations of the service facilities along a freeway. The first one is a simulation model, called FREEQ, which can be employed to generate all necessary information such as total travel time, individual average travel time on the freeway, provided that the demand pattern and the physical configuration of the freeway are known. Based upon these results, an optimization model is used to search for the best locations of the service facilities so that the total delay time caused by the accident or incident or the response time of the service unit is minimized.
